Costs and Fees

Many personal injury lawyers operate on a contingency fee basis. This means you only pay them if they secure a settlement or win your case. Fees typically range from 25% to 40% of the recovery amount. Always discuss fees upfront and ensure you understand what to expect.

How Compensation is Calculated in Personal Injury Cases

When you suffer an injury due to someone else’s negligence, one of your primary concerns will be how to obtain fair compensation for your losses. Understanding how compensation is calculated in personal injury cases is essential in navigating this complex landscape. The amount you may receive can vary widely based on several critical factors.

The compensation mainly falls into two categories: economic and non-economic damages. Economic damages are tangible losses and easy to quantify, while non-economic damages involve subjective aspects of your injury.

Economic Damages

These damages primarily include:

  • Medical Expenses: This includes hospital bills, rehabilitation costs, and ongoing medical treatment required due to the injury.
  • Lost Wages: If your injuries prevent you from working, you can seek compensation for lost earnings. This includes both past and future income loss.
  • Property Damage: If your personal belongings were damaged in the incident, you can recover for repairs or replacement.

To assess these economic damages, your personal injury lawyer in Arlington, VA, will gather all relevant paperwork — medical bills, pay stubs, and other receipts — to create a clear picture of your financial losses.

Non-Economic Damages

Non-economic damages are more challenging to quantify, yet they are equally vital for your recovery. These may include:

  • Pain and Suffering: This refers to the physical and emotional distress resulting from the injury.
  • Emotional Distress: Psychological injuries such as anxiety, depression, or PTSD due to the traumatic event can be compensated.
  • Loss of Enjoyment of Life: If your injury limits your ability to partake in activities you once enjoyed, you may be entitled to compensation for this loss.

Determining the value of non-economic damages typically requires the assistance of legal professionals who can apply appropriate calculation methods. Some may use a multiplier approach, where the total economic damages are multiplied by a factor (usually between 1.5 and 5) based on the severity of the injury.

Factors Influencing Compensation

Several critical factors can affect the calculated compensation in personal injury cases:

  • Severity of Injury: More severe injuries generally lead to higher compensation amounts.
  • Long-Term Impact: Chronic pain or long-term disabilities can significantly impact your damage calculation.
  • Liability: The degree to which the at-fault party is found liable can also affect the final compensation. In Virginia, the contributory negligence rule means that if you are found even 1% at fault, you may not recover any damages.
  • Jurisdiction: Compensation amounts can vary widely based on state laws and the typical settlement amounts in the local area.

Fact: Time Limits Exist for Filing Claims

In Virginia, there is a statute of limitations which restricts how long you have to file a personal injury claim. Generally, you have two years from the date of the injury to initiate a lawsuit. Missing this deadline could result in losing your right to seek compensation for your injuries.
